u/Powerful_Glove_666 Aug 11 '25 edited Aug 11 '25

Ok so the online release is a subscriber only edition, but according to what's been claimed by people who are subscribed, what RTD had to say about Who basically starts and ends with him reiterating that he doesn't know what's happening right now. He is employed by Bad Wolf and they are apparently not privvy to current high level official talks between Disney and the BBC! But he believes a press release will be issued "in due course", and is happy with how The War Between the Land and the Sea has turned out. That's it.
